resgen批量resources转换resx工具.zip


在.NET框架中,资源文件是应用程序中存储非代码数据(如文本、图像、音频或视频)的关键组件。它们可以通过两种主要格式表示:`.resx`和`.resources`。`.resx`文件是一种XML格式,可以直接在Visual Studio中编辑,便于程序员和设计者协作。而`.resources`文件是二进制格式,通常用于编译后的程序集,以提高运行时性能。 标题"resgen批量resources转换resx工具.zip"所提到的是一个实用工具,用于解决在使用ILSpy等反编译工具后遇到的问题。ILSpy是一款开源的.NET反编译器,它能将编译后的.NET程序集反编译回源代码。然而,在反编译过程中,Winform窗体中的`.resx`资源文件可能会被转换为`.resources`格式,这给那些习惯于直接查看和编辑`.resx`文件的开发者带来了不便。 描述中提到的情况指出,开发人员可能需要将这些`.resources`文件批量转换回`.resx`格式,以便更好地理解和维护代码。为此,这个压缩包提供了一个名为"resgen批量resources转换resx工具"的解决方案。`ResGen.exe`是.NET框架自带的一个命令行工具,可以用于在`.resx`和`.resources`之间进行转换。但是,手动操作对于大量文件来说效率低下,所以这个工具很可能是对`ResGen.exe`的一个批处理封装,简化了整个过程。 该工具的工作原理可能包括以下步骤: 1. 遍历指定目录下的所有`.resources`文件。 2. 使用`ResGen.exe`命令行工具将每个`.resources`文件转换为相应的`.resx`文件。 3. 可能会保留原始文件名或根据需要重命名新生成的`.resx`文件。 4. 提供转换日志,记录成功或失败的操作。 在实际开发中,这种工具可以大大提高工作效率,特别是对于那些处理大量资源文件的大型Winform项目。通过批量转换,开发者可以继续使用他们熟悉的`.resx`文件进行设计和编辑工作,而无需直接操作二进制`.resources`文件。 总结一下,这个压缩包提供的工具是针对.NET开发者的一个实用辅助,特别是那些使用Winform和ILSpy的用户。它能够帮助他们快速地将反编译后的`.resources`文件批量转换回易于管理的`.resx`格式,从而简化代码的查看和维护工作。使用此工具时,开发者只需提供包含`.resources`文件的目录,工具就会自动完成转换任务,极大地提高了开发的便捷性和效率。

























- 1



- 粉丝: 163
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源


